    Last year i challenged myself to do a monster a day...but fell short. This year I am doing the alphabet rendered out...SO once i finish i will do a final render of all and put them together. I would consider these unfinsihed right now because i try to spend 1-2 hours on them but i know i want to go back when I am done and rework them all...things I know I need to change or finsh. SO...this will be my entry when i am done. ALL are created in Zbrush only using alphas for the initial creation of the letters.

    Thanks guys, here is what i have so far. R2 and Dynamesh are DEFINETLY helping me get these done quicker for sure. Taking a basic sketch and modelling out what I envisioned. I wish I had a little time to jump into the new rendering settings with the lightcap and HDRI backgrounds and I may for the final. But I have had so much fun on all of these so far. I got a couple of challenging letters coming up.
